Commit 6e3a293a by 朱继来

Merge branch 'master' of http://119.23.72.7/zhujilai/Order into zjl_self_express_20181030

parents 9a0da6d4 bc69f462
...@@ -288,19 +288,15 @@ Class AddOrderController extends Controller ...@@ -288,19 +288,15 @@ Class AddOrderController extends Controller
{ {
if ($request->isMethod('post')) { if ($request->isMethod('post')) {
$url = Config('website.search-skuid'); $url = Config('website.search-skuid');
$data['sku_id'] = $request->input('sku_id'); $data['id'] = $request->input('sku_id');
$goods_type = $request->input('goods_type');
$response = json_decode(curlApi($url, $data, 'POST'), true); $data['k1'] = time();
$data['k2'] = md5(md5($data['k1']).'fh6y5t4rr351d2c3bryi');
if ($goods_type == 1) { $response = json_decode(curlApi($url, $data, 'POST'), true);
$goods_info = $response['data']['sku'];
} else {
$goods_info = $response['data'];
}
if (!empty($goods_info)) { if (!empty($response['data'])) {
return ['errcode' => 0, 'errmsg' => '', 'data' => $goods_info]; return ['errcode' => 0, 'errmsg' => '', 'data' => $response['data']];
} else { } else {
return ['errcode' => -1, 'errmsg' => '未找SKU信息']; return ['errcode' => -1, 'errmsg' => '未找SKU信息'];
} }
......
...@@ -51,8 +51,9 @@ return [ ...@@ -51,8 +51,9 @@ return [
'check-user-url' => 'http://member.liexin.net/list', 'check-user-url' => 'http://member.liexin.net/list',
// 查询SKUID接口 // 查询SKUID接口
'search-skuid' => 'http://footstone.liexin.net/webapi/goods_details', // 'search-skuid' => 'http://footstone.liexin.net/webapi/sku_list',
// 'search-skuid' => 'http://www.liexin.com/v3/sku/list', // 'search-skuid' => 'http://www.liexin.com/v3/sku/list',
'search-skuid' => 'http://api.liexin.com/goods/detail',
// 新增SKU入口 // 新增SKU入口
'add-sku-url' => 'http://footstone.liexin.net/manage/addsku', 'add-sku-url' => 'http://footstone.liexin.net/manage/addsku',
......
...@@ -220,9 +220,9 @@ ...@@ -220,9 +220,9 @@
$.ajax({ $.ajax({
url: '/ajax/getSku', url: '/ajax/getSku',
type: 'post', type: 'post',
data: {sku_id : sku_id.trim(), goods_type: goods_type}, data: {sku_id : sku_id.trim()},
dataType: 'json', dataType: 'json',
success: function (resp) { success: function (resp) { console.log(resp)
if (resp.errcode != 0) { if (resp.errcode != 0) {
layer.msg(resp.errmsg); layer.msg(resp.errmsg);
return false; return false;
...@@ -236,74 +236,77 @@ ...@@ -236,74 +236,77 @@
$('.goods_name').text(data.goods_name); $('.goods_name').text(data.goods_name);
$('.brand_name').text(data.brand_name); $('.brand_name').text(data.brand_name);
$('.supplier_name').text(data.supplier_name); $('.supplier_name').text(data.supplier_name);
$('.stock').text(data.stock); $('.stock').text(data.goods_number);
$('.moq').text(data.moq); $('.moq').text(data.min_buy);
$('.mpq').text(data.mpq); $('.mpq').text(data.min_mpq);
if (goods_type == 1) { // if (goods_type == 1) {
var status = data.goods_status; // var status = data.goods_status;
} else { // } else {
var status = data.status; // var status = data.status;
} // }
switch (status) { // switch (status) {
case 0: status_val = '待入库'; break; // case 0: status_val = '待入库'; break;
case 1: status_val = '审核通过(上架)'; break; // case 1: status_val = '审核通过(上架)'; break;
case 3: status_val = '下架'; break; // case 3: status_val = '下架'; break;
case 4: status_val = '删除'; break; // case 4: status_val = '删除'; break;
} // }
status_val = data.is_buy ? '是' : '否';
$('.status').text(status_val); $('.status').text(status_val);
$('.goods_id').val(data.goods_id); $('.goods_id').val(data.goods_id);
$('.goods_type').val(data.goods_type); $('.goods_type').val(data.goods_type);
//阶梯价格 //阶梯价格
if (data.ladder_price != null) { if (data.tiered != null) {
if (data.ladder_price.constructor == String) { //如果阶梯价为字符串,则转换为数字 var len = data.tiered.length;
var price_arr = eval(data.ladder_price);
} else {
var price_arr = data.ladder_price;
}
var len = price_arr.length;
if (len > 0) { if (len > 0) {
var html = ''; var html = '';
html += '<tr><th>阶梯</th><th>RMB价格</th>';
if (data.ac_type == 1) {
html += '<th>活动价</th>';
}
if (goods_type == 1) {
html += '<th>USD价格</th>';
}
html += '</tr>';
for (var i = 0; i < len; i++) { for (var i = 0; i < len; i++) {
html += '<tr>'; html += '<tr>';
if (i == 0) { if (i == 0) {
if (data.ac_type) { if (data.ac_type) {
html += '<td><span class="goods-min-num">'+price_arr[i]['purchases']+'</span></td><td>¥<span class="goods-min-price price-line">'+price_arr[i]['price_cn']+'</span><td>¥<span>'+price_arr[i]['price_ac']+'</span></td>'; html += '<td><span class="goods-min-num">'+data.tiered[i]['purchases']+'</span></td><td>¥<span class="goods-min-price price-line">'+data.tiered[i]['price_cn']+'</span><td>¥<span>'+data.tiered[i]['price_ac']+'</span></td>';
} else { } else {
html += '<td><span class="goods-min-num">'+price_arr[i]['purchases']+'</span></td><td>¥<span class="goods-min-price">'+price_arr[i]['price_cn']+'</span></td>'; html += '<td><span class="goods-min-num">'+data.tiered[i]['purchases']+'</span></td><td>¥<span class="goods-min-price">'+data.tiered[i]['price_cn']+'</span></td>';
} }
if (goods_type == 1) { if (goods_type == 1) {
html += '<td>$<span class="goods-min-price-us">'+price_arr[i]['price_us']+'</span></td>'; html += '<td>$<span class="goods-min-price-us">'+data.tiered[i]['price_us']+'</span></td>';
} }
} else { } else {
if (data.ac_type) { if (data.ac_type) {
html += '<td><span>'+price_arr[i]['purchases']+'</span></td><td>¥<span class="price-line">'+price_arr[i]['price_cn']+'</span></td><td>¥<span>'+price_arr[i]['price_ac']+'</span></td>'; html += '<td><span>'+data.tiered[i]['purchases']+'</span></td><td>¥<span class="price-line">'+data.tiered[i]['price_cn']+'</span></td><td>¥<span>'+data.tiered[i]['price_ac']+'</span></td>';
} else { } else {
html += '<td><span>'+price_arr[i]['purchases']+'</span></td><td>¥<span>'+price_arr[i]['price_cn']+'</span></td>'; html += '<td><span>'+data.tiered[i]['purchases']+'</span></td><td>¥<span>'+data.tiered[i]['price_cn']+'</span></td>';
} }
if (goods_type == 1) { if (goods_type == 1) {
html += '<td>$<span>'+price_arr[i]['price_us']+'</span></td>'; html += '<td>$<span>'+data.tiered[i]['price_us']+'</span></td>';
} }
} }
html += '</tr>'; html += '</tr>';
} }
if (data.ac_type == 1) { // $('.ladder_price_table tr:gt(0)').remove();
$('.ladder_price_table tr:eq(0)').append('<th>活动价</th>') $('.ladder_price_table').empty().append(html);
}
$('.ladder_price_table tr:gt(0)').remove();
$('.ladder_price_table').append(html);
} }
} }
} }
...@@ -334,7 +337,7 @@ ...@@ -334,7 +337,7 @@
return false; return false;
} }
if (type == 0) { if (type == 3 || type == 4) {
layer.msg('仅支持联营商品下单,请在自营订单中下单'); layer.msg('仅支持联营商品下单,请在自营订单中下单');
return false; return false;
} }
......
...@@ -301,7 +301,7 @@ ...@@ -301,7 +301,7 @@
<div class="row"> <div class="row">
<div class="col-sm-6"> <div class="col-sm-6">
<div class="form-group"> <div class="form-group">
<span>状态</span> <span>是否能购买</span>
<span class="status"></span> <span class="status"></span>
</div> </div>
</div> </div>
...@@ -310,10 +310,10 @@ ...@@ -310,10 +310,10 @@
<div class="sku-info-right"> <div class="sku-info-right">
<table class="table table-hover ladder_price_table"> <table class="table table-hover ladder_price_table">
<tr> <!-- <tr>
<th>阶梯</th> <th>阶梯</th>
<th>RMB价格</th> <th>RMB价格</th>
</tr> </tr> -->
</table> </table>
</div> </div>
......
...@@ -320,7 +320,7 @@ ...@@ -320,7 +320,7 @@
<div class="row"> <div class="row">
<div class="col-sm-6"> <div class="col-sm-6">
<div class="form-group"> <div class="form-group">
<span>状态</span> <span>是否能购买</span>
<span class="status"></span> <span class="status"></span>
</div> </div>
</div> </div>
...@@ -329,11 +329,11 @@ ...@@ -329,11 +329,11 @@
<div class="sku-info-right"> <div class="sku-info-right">
<table class="table table-hover ladder_price_table"> <table class="table table-hover ladder_price_table">
<tr> <!-- <tr>
<th>阶梯</th> <th>阶梯</th>
<th>RMB价格</th> <th>RMB价格</th>
<th>USD价格</th> <th>USD价格</th>
</tr> </tr> -->
</table> </table>
</div> </div>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ment